description Tambora fumaroles Overview
The fumaroles of Mount Tambora are steam and gas vents produced by geothermal activity within the volcano's caldera on Sumbawa Island, Indonesia. Tambora is known for its exceptionally large eruption in 1815, which caused widespread local destruction and significant climatic effects around the world. The fumaroles are later surface expressions of heat and volcanic gases beneath the caldera. They are part of the active volcanic landscape monitored for changes in temperature, gas release, and seismic activity.
